Advice & Tips
I am not sure how well this is working now after 4 months in, I had what may have been external thrush recently which I treated with an antifungal cream for a couple of days, and the symptoms subsided. I haven't had any examinations to actually determine if I have any thrush, and I also have had times where I was concerned it was coming back, but the major symptoms I was experiencing before the treatment have not returned.
